h-Principles for smooth curves and knots with prescribed curvature
Abstract
We show that smooth curves with prescribed curvature satisfy a C1-dense h-principle in the space of immersed curves in Euclidean space. More precisely, every Cα ≥ 2 curve with nonvanishing curvature in Rn≥ 3 can be C1-approximated by Cα curves of any larger curvature, prescribed as a function of arclength. It follows that there exist C∞ knots of prescribed curvature in every isotopy class of closed curves embedded in R3.
